Vishal-Shekhar: We're doing whatever we can to save our song

Updated On: 03 February, 2020 07:34 AM IST | Sonia Lulla

Vishal Dadlani and Shekhar Ravjiani intervene to take charge of rehashed version of their 2005 original, Dus bahane, after learning that Baaghi 3 makers were working on one.

Vishal Dadlani and Shekhar Ravjiani

Upon its release 15 years ago, Vishal Dadlani and Shekhar Ravjiani's Dus bahane became a party anthem of sorts. Now, the fast-paced number from Dus (2005) has been revisited by Tiger Shroff and Shraddha Kapoor for Baaghi 3. In an age where Bollywood songs are constantly being reinvented, Dadlani has been at the forefront, criticising the trend.

In a previous interview with mid-day, he had referred to his slate of angry tweets when reiterating that he wouldn't take lightly to filmmakers contemplating remixing their songs, asserting that the feat may take away from the body of work of artistes who were "trying to create a legacy". It hence took us by surprise when we learnt that the duo was willing to rehash their own song. In a joint statement, the duo says, "We're doing whatever we can to save our song. It had already been shot to some chop-shop version, before we found out and objected. We insisted on creative approval, remuneration and primary and sole credit for our composition. Thankfully, everyone concerned has recognised and understood our right to protect our work, [and] our refusal to allow it to be released with anyone else's name on it. Ahmed Khan and Sajid Nadiadwala have been supportive. Bhushan Kumar too had a long chat and promised to never re-use our music without our involvement. Since this had already been shot to a version we didn't particularly care for, we are now trying to fix it so that a song that we all love, and one that has stood the passage of 16 years, isn't reduced to merely another shoddy "remix"."
